thinkphp3.x连接mysql数据库的方法(具体操作步骤)

作者:yanhui_wei 时间:2023-11-22 20:04:41 

本文实例讲述了thinkphp3.x连接mysql数据库的方法。分享给大家供大家参考,具体如下:

惯例配置文件:ThinkPHP/conf/convention.php

(1)在配置文件中填写配置信息(配置文件:“./xmall/conf/config.php”):

示例:


<?php
return array(
  //'配置项'=>'配置值'
  /* 数据库设置 */
   'DB_TYPE'    => 'mysql',  // 数据库类型
   'DB_HOST'    => 'localhost', // 服务器地址
   'DB_NAME'    => 'xmall',  // 数据库名
   'DB_USER'    => 'root',  // 用户名
   'DB_PWD'    => '123', // 密码
   'DB_PORT'    => '3306',  // 端口
   'DB_PREFIX'    => 'think_', // 数据库表前缀
   'DB_FIELDTYPE_CHECK' => false,  // 是否进行字段类型检查
   'DB_FIELDS_CACHE'  => true,  // 启用字段缓存
   'DB_CHARSET'   => 'utf8',  // 数据库编码默认采用utf8
);
?>

(2)创建表:


CREATE TABLE `think_user` (
 `id` int(11) DEFAULT NULL,
 `name` varchar(30) DEFAULT NULL,
 `pwd` varchar(20) DEFAULT NULL
) ENGINE=InnoDB;

(3) 执行数据插入操作在lib/Action下修改IndexAction.class.php文件,内容如下:


<?php
class IndexAction extends Action{
  function index(){
    public function index(){
      $data=array(
         "id"=>"1",
         "name="=>"liuning",
        "pwd"=>"asd123"
      );
      M("user")->add($data);
    }
  }
}
?>

(4)执行http://localhost/xmall/index.php,数据库中就会有新的记录生成;

希望本文所述对大家基于ThinkPHP框架的PHP程序设计有所帮助。

标签:thinkphp,mysql
0
投稿

猜你喜欢

  • opencv-python图像增强解读

    2022-10-10 04:29:16
  • MySQL索引之主键索引

    2024-01-25 01:52:04
  • Python利用Faiss库实现ANN近邻搜索的方法详解

    2021-11-17 19:35:02
  • python用700行代码实现http客户端

    2021-12-06 20:32:49
  • SQL语句练习实例之四 找出促销活动中销售额最高的职员

    2011-11-03 16:47:03
  • TensorFlow 滑动平均的示例代码

    2023-10-25 15:41:28
  • python利用dlib获取人脸的68个landmark

    2023-07-25 15:28:19
  • RR与RC隔离级别下索引和锁的测试脚本示例代码

    2024-01-17 06:36:25
  • HTTP请求 GET与POST方法的区别

    2023-07-26 12:46:35
  • Python tkinter布局与按钮间距设置方式

    2023-09-28 23:43:27
  • python图形开发GUI库pyqt5的基本使用方法详解

    2022-07-08 02:31:55
  • 详解用webpack把我们的业务模块分开打包的方法

    2024-04-27 15:18:07
  • CSS绝对定位在宽屏分辨率下错位

    2009-07-28 12:24:00
  • Python中字典的基本知识初步介绍

    2021-08-25 11:41:40
  • Python中的优先队列(priority queue)和堆(heap)

    2023-11-22 05:40:03
  • python实现简单飞行棋

    2021-07-24 23:02:14
  • 详解javascript遍历方式

    2023-10-14 16:44:48
  • python实现差分隐私Laplace机制详解

    2022-01-08 16:37:41
  • SQL实现相邻两行数据的加减乘除操作

    2024-01-24 23:12:34
  • Python cookbook(数据结构与算法)实现对不原生支持比较操作的对象排序算法示例

    2021-08-14 18:38:06
  • asp之家 网络编程 m.aspxhome.com